Australia - Great Ocean Road bushfire losses to top $150m

15.02.2016 405 views
Figures on agricultural losses from major bushfires this fire season at Scotsburn, Barnawartha and Lancefield show that farms have suffered significant damage. Some farmers have lost thousands of dollars in equipment, livestock and future earnings. Almost 4700 livestock (mostly sheep) were killed, 590 kilometres of farm fences and 99 sheds were destroyed and seven hectares of orchard plantings or grapes burnt. The fires also burnt more than 4200 hectares of pasture and destroyed almost 450 tonnes of hay. Source - theage.com.au
